Output 30370f5b63368ddf26538b47a0341c77d60bab3b64f18d9f9240d11a54e94031:0

value
1013172
script pubkey
OP_HASH160 OP_PUSHBYTES_20 835635da63edc9fd06b2ea76099f782db4f40d2b OP_EQUAL
address
3DfTig5f9MhdzrSHBvjazLbRPSvTHBQcqt
transaction
30370f5b63368ddf26538b47a0341c77d60bab3b64f18d9f9240d11a54e94031
spent
true